Задание:
В процессе работы над проектом была разработана структура базы данных, предназначенная для учета персональных компьютеров и их комплектующих. Основной целью являлось создание удобного и функционального инструмента для хранения и управления информацией о различных устройствах и их компонентах.
Система состоит из нескольких ключевых таблиц, каждая из которых отвечает за определенный аспект учета. В таблице "Компьютеры" хранятся основные сведения о каждом устройстве: его марка, модель, серийный номер, дата приобретения и текущее состояние. Для более подробного учета также была добавлена таблица "Комплектующие", в которой фиксируются данные о процессорах, видеокартах, материнских платах и других компонентах, используемых в собранных ПК. Эти таблицы связаны между собой, что позволяет легко получать информацию о том, какие комплектующие установлены в каждом компьютере.
Особое внимание было уделено функционалу поиска и фильтрации данных. Пользователь может быстро находить необходимые элементы по различным критериям, таким как тип устройства, производитель или состояние. Это значительно упрощает задачу управления оборудованием, особенно в учебных заведениях или организациях, где требуется постоянный мониторинг и обновление информации.
Для повышения удобства работы с базой данных была реализована пользовательская форма, которая позволяет вносить новые данные и редактировать существующие записи через интуитивно понятный интерфейс. Внедренная система контроля доступа обеспечивает безопасность, позволяя различным категориям пользователей выполнять только авторизованные операции.
Проектирование базы данных включало в себя также создание резервных копий, что важно для защиты информации от потери. В дальнейшем планируется внедрение системы отчетности, которая позволит анализировать информацию о состоянии и использовании компьютеров и комплектующих.
Таким образом, созданная система представляет собой надежный инструмент для учета, который может быть адаптирован в зависимости от потребностей пользователя и значительно упростить процессы управления компьютерным оборудованием.